One of the most iconic skateboard parks in the UK is the Southbank Skate Park, located in London This historical skateboarding spot has been a mecca for riders since the 1970s and continues to attract skaters from all over the world The park features a variety of obstacles and ramps, catering to skateboarders of all skill levels With its vibrant atmosphere and prime location along the River Thames, Southbank Skate Park offers a truly unique and exhilarating skateboarding experience.
Moving up north, we come across the Manchester Skate Plaza, a state-of-the-art skateboard park that has become a popular destination for riders in the region This expansive park features a mix of street and transition elements, including rails, ledges, banks, and quarter pipes The park’s layout allows riders to flow seamlessly from one obstacle to the next, providing an exciting and challenging environment for skaters to hone their skills With its modern design and diverse features, the Manchester Skate Plaza offers a dynamic and engaging experience for riders of all backgrounds.

Heading towards the south coast, we encounter the Brighton Skate Park, a popular seaside spot for skateboarders in the UK Nestled along the picturesque Brighton Beach, this expansive skate park features a mix of concrete bowls, ramps, and ledges, providing riders with plenty of options to showcase their skills The park’s scenic backdrop and laid-back atmosphere make it a favorite destination for skaters looking to enjoy a day by the sea while perfecting their tricks Whether you’re a local rider or a visitor to the area, the Brighton Skate Park offers a welcoming and inclusive environment for skateboard enthusiasts.
In addition to these well-known skateboard parks, the UK is home to a plethora of smaller, community-built skate spots that cater to local riders These DIY skate parks may not have the same level of infrastructure as larger parks, but they offer a grassroots and authentic skateboarding experience that is cherished by many in the skating community These hidden gems may be tucked away in urban alleyways or empty lots, but they provide a space for skaters to express themselves and connect with like-minded individuals.
